Ontario Reign Game Preview: Reign and Rampage Collide in Ontario Tonight on $2 Beer Friday

October 30, 2015 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Ontario Reign News Release


Ontario, CA - The Ontario Reign, proud American Hockey League (AHL) of the Los Angeles Kings of the National Hockey League (NHL), host the San Antonio Rampage tonight at 7:00 at Citizens Business Bank Arena in Ontario, California. Tonight is the first of six meetings between the two teams.

#Winning:

The Reign enter tonight's contest on a season-opening five-game winning streak.

Something's Gotta Give:

The Reign (5-0-0) and Rampage (3-0-1) are the only unbeaten teams remaining in the AHL to start the season.

Fight Power with Power:

The Reign hold the AHL's best defense (1.00 goals-against per game) while San Antonio boasts the league's third-best offense (4.00 goals-scored per game).

Special Teams are Special:

Rolling into tonight's contest, the Reign hold the second-best penalty kill in the American Hockey League at 96.2 percent (one goal against on 26 chances) and host the league's third-best power play in San Antonio at 26.3 percent (five goals scored on 19 chances). Not to be overlooked, the Reign's power play currently stands sixth at 23.5 percent (four goals on 17 chances).

Fire Away:

The Reign average 34.20 shots per game, the second most in the AHL, and allow only 22.20 shots against, first in the league.

Helping Others:

Forward Sean Backman enters tonight's game on a five-game assists streak with six assists.
